A group including Amazon founder Jeff Bezos advances its talks to buy about a 30% stake in Liverpool, BBC Sport has been told.

What happened

Talks are progressing for a consortium involving Jeff Bezos to take a stake in Liverpool FC. The move would represent a significant shift in the club's ownership structure. Details on the size of the stake and valuation remain unclear at this stage. Liverpool are currently owned by Fenway Sports Group, who have owned the club since 2010.

Chance analysis

A potential ownership change or investment at Liverpool would have long-term implications for the club's transfer budget, strategic direction, and competitive positioning. While this doesn't directly affect on-field performance in the short term, a Bezos-backed consortium could significantly increase Liverpool's financial firepower. The story is still developing and at the negotiation stage, not confirmed.
